Transaction 61e631c92968737e077b744de9451d64489eab6c7d7d4d4256c984ac8ebf2d4a

2 Input
2 Outputs
  • 61e631c92968737e077b744de9451d64489eab6c7d7d4d4256c984ac8ebf2d4a:0
  • value  1348784
    address  3DcjHhHg5VDfjHo7D6uhUrk86PFJ2Dwa14
  • 61e631c92968737e077b744de9451d64489eab6c7d7d4d4256c984ac8ebf2d4a:1
  • value  1120269
    address  3KqEMtsdjeYMwR5AKz1DXC1y5nxKJoN3bU